Chapter 1135: Past Events
Ling Feng sat in the car, staring at the situation upstairs, feeling a wave of speechlessness in his heart.
He had no interest in listening to the two people’s meaningless chatter; all he wanted was to hear them talk about Mu Lingling.
Unfortunately, it seemed he had missed it, as he didn’t hear them mention her at all.
But after a while, Tian Hao suddenly asked, "What’s your plan for that guy with the surname Ling?"
"First, find Mu Lingling, then force the guy with the surname Ling to come out. I want them both dead!" Li Yan replied.
The words were spoken casually, as if two lives were worthless in her eyes.
And Tian Hao wasn’t surprised at all; he grinned and said, "Alright, but there are too many nosy people in Tang Family Village. We’ll need to figure out a way to lure them into the wild."
"Don’t worry, once night falls and everything is quiet, no one will see," Li Yan said.
"Coincidentally, I have two friends coming over today. When the time comes, we’ll hand Mu Lingling over to them, and you can enjoy a good show. How’s that?" Tian Hao asked.
Li Yan’s face lit up with joy as soon as she heard this. "Great, that’s even better!"
In the car, Ling Feng’s face had already turned grim. He hadn’t expected this shameless pair to be so utterly devoid of morals!
If it weren’t for the people he was waiting for, he would’ve already charged upstairs!
Suppressing his fury, Ling Feng drove off from Hongqi Town, fearing he might lose control if he stayed.
He initially planned to wait for the people Li Yan had called over and eliminate them all, but after some thought, he realized that doing so would mean Mu Lingling wouldn’t see the darkness in people’s hearts!
So Ling Feng decided to give her a lesson, to let her understand the true faces of her friends!
Of course, Mu Lingling would undoubtedly be hurt by this, but Ling Feng felt it was necessary for her to grow. At worst, she could take a few days to recover.
Leaving Hongqi Town, Ling Feng didn’t return to Shankou Village. Instead, he drove straight to Tang Family Village’s elementary school.
He didn’t have Mu Lingling’s phone number, so he could only shout from outside the wall. Mu Lingling, who was preparing lesson plans in the dormitory, heard him and stepped out.
"Brother Ling, you’re here! Are you looking for me?"
Ling Feng smiled faintly. "I have something to talk to you about."
"Oh, then come on in," Mu Lingling said as she opened the iron gate.
Ling Feng followed her into the dormitory. While surveilling Li Yan and Tian Hao earlier, he had already studied the room’s layout. It was quite simple, with a small kitchen and just a bed and desk in the bedroom.
Mu Lingling sat on the edge of the bed and offered the chair to Ling Feng, then asked, "Brother Ling, what’s the matter?"
Ling Feng didn’t rush to answer. Instead, he picked up a photo frame on the desk. The photo inside featured five people—two men and three women. Ling Feng asked, "Who are these people?"
"My classmates. Li Yan and Tian Hao are in the photo," Mu Lingling replied.
Ling Feng stared at the photograph and finally recognized the two of them.
The photo had been taken at least a year ago; back then, they hadn’t left school yet. Their faces were still youthful, quite different from now.
Ling Feng looked at the other two, a man and a woman, and curiously asked, "Who are these two?"
"Our classmates too. One’s named Li Tong, and the other’s Hu Xue," Mu Lingling replied.
Ling Feng made an acknowledging sound before asking, "Where are these two working now?"
"Well..."
Mu Lingling’s expression darkened. She sighed and said, "Li Tong has passed away, and Hu Xue went missing. She still hasn’t been found."
"Oh?"
Ling Feng narrowed his eyes. "Is that so?"
"Yes, back when we were in school, the five of us were closest. But I didn’t expect things to turn out this way. I was heartbroken for a long time before I finally got over it," Mu Lingling said.
Ling Feng looked at her. "What happened to Li Tong? Why did he die?"
"He accidentally fell off a cliff. We were hiking at the time, and he insisted on venturing outside the scenic area. That’s when it happened," Mu Lingling explained.
"I see. And Hu Xue went missing after that?" Ling Feng asked.
"No, she disappeared later, about half a month afterward. She left school and never came back," Mu Lingling said.
Ling Feng fell silent.
After a while, he asked, "Was Li Tong your boyfriend?"
"No. He was very good to me, but I felt I was still young and didn’t want to be tied down, so I declined," Mu Lingling replied.
Ling Feng made another acknowledging sound and continued to ask, "Did Li Yan and Hu Xue both like Li Tong?"
"Well, maybe? We often joked about it while hanging out, but I’m not sure if they really liked him," Mu Lingling replied.
By now, Ling Feng had pieced together the key details. It seemed Li Yan’s hatred for Mu Lingling might be rooted in Li Tong!
These answers could have been easily verified; all Ling Feng needed to do was capture Li Yan and read her thoughts directly. But he was asking Mu Lingling these questions mainly to help her realize the truth herself.
After asking what he wanted, Ling Feng looked at her and said, "You’ll be staying in the dorm all day today, right? You won’t go out?"
"Yes, I need to prepare lesson plans and midterm exam papers. Is something wrong, Brother Ling?" Mu Lingling asked.
"Nothing’s wrong. Just stay in the dorm until it gets dark. I might come by tonight," Ling Feng said.
"Huh?"
Mu Lingling froze for a moment, then blushed. "You’re coming to see me tonight?"
"Don’t misunderstand. Something might happen tonight; I’m just giving you a heads-up. As for what it is, I won’t say more to avoid affecting your mood!" Ling Feng explained.
Mu Lingling sighed in response, "You’ve already affected my mood!"
"Uh..."
Ling Feng chuckled awkwardly and said, "How about you focus on your work for now? You might forget about this later!"
"Alright."
Mu Lingling glanced at him, then asked, "What time are you coming?"
"I’m not sure yet. Probably in the afternoon," Ling Feng replied.
After thinking for a moment, he added, "Why not prepare your lesson plans at Sister Xiaoqian’s house? She has that big black dog; even if someone comes, they won’t dare to mess around!"
"..."
Mu Lingling looked even more confused. She asked in bewilderment, "What exactly is going to happen? Are bad people coming for me?"
"Something like that," Ling Feng admitted, finding it hard to explain further. His face was full of helplessness.
Seeing his expression, Mu Lingling chose not to press further. She nodded and said, "Alright, I’ll head over now!"
"Okay, I’ll take you there!"
After tidying up, the two left the dormitory and went to Tang Xiaoqian’s house.
Ling Feng stayed for a while before preparing to leave, but just then, Big Black’s barking rang out from the yard—someone had arrived!
Ling Feng froze, wondering if Li Yan and her group had come earlier than planned. Were they ahead of schedule?
